// Constants for the Furrowlink telemetry gateway.
// If you're writing a plugin, read this before fiddling: tractors in the
// Dunmore test fields push bursts of sensor frames whenever they cross a
// field boundary, so the ingest buffers are sized for spikes, not averages.
// Shrink them and you'll drop frames; grow them and the little edge boxes
// run out of RAM. The agreed-upon values live right here.

tuning constants:
QUOTAS = {
    "druwyn": 5,
    "holix": 5,
    "zorath": 5,
    "holwyn": 10,
}

# Ticket-pricing experiment — FareLoom variant B
# Scope: Quillhaven venue group only. Do not enable elsewhere.
# EXPERIMENT_BUCKET_PCT=15 — leave at 15 until week two review.
# PRICE_FLOOR_CENTS=800 — hard floor; refunds escalate if breached.
# SURGE_MULTIPLIER_MAX=1.4 — capped per legal guidance.
# Support: if a customer reports a price mismatch, check their bucket
# assignment in the admin panel before issuing credits.
# The pricing service verifies experiment assignments with a shared
# secret, configured on the line below:

secret setting of fawep-tagaf: ARCHIVE_KEY3=ce5

Changelog — Gatewright 2.9

Renamed RATE_LIMIT_TOKENS to GW_RATE_BUCKET_SIZE; the old name is ignored as of this release. On-call: update gateway.env on both Harlowe clusters before the next restart, or limits fall back to defaults and shed traffic. The bucket-size line must be immediately followed by the gateway's limiter signing secret, so add that line now.

env line for fafof-fahag: LEDGER_TOKEN5=f8790

Off-site run — item 4

- Collect master copies from Quillstone Press, rear loading bay, before 10:00.
- Masters are irreplaceable; hard case only, no soft sleeves.
- Do not stack under other freight.
- Sign the release sheet at the bay window; Tomas holds it.
- Confirm count: three folders, sealed.
- Return run goes direct, no intermediate stops.
- Hand-over instruction for the courier follows below.

dispatch memo: the lamwyn fenwyn courier leaves the wenir ledger at gate 7175 under passcode 822969